My Vitamin D was that low pre-op too. I started taking more D and it got up pretty easily. I think D is one that we don't really have issues with absorbing so just taking some is fine.

I wouldn't worry about how much. You are going to get follow-up labs and if your D is over 100, you can just take less. Toxicity with Vitamin D is much higher than that and you aren't goin to go from 30 to 300 in 6 months.

Normies are told to get 2000  IU a day as a reference.
